Hay Foot

Hay Foot

Year: 1942

Runtime: 48 mins

Language: English

Director: Fred Guiol

RomanceComedy

With the same cast as the earlier army comedy, Colonel Barkley admires his assistant Sergeant Doubleday, who has a photographic memory. Doubleday flaunts textbook firearms knowledge in Sgt. Ames’s class, embarrassing Ames. Misunderstandings lead Barkley to think Doubly is a marksman, and he pits him against Ames and Sgt. Cobb in a shooting match.

In a bustling Army post where discipline meets slapstick, the daily grind is flavored with a generous helping of comedy. The garrison’s commanding officer, Colonel Barkley, runs his regiment with a blend of strict order and good‑natured indulgence, often finding himself drawn to the quirks of those under his command. His particular fascination with one of his aides sets the tone for a story that balances military routine with off‑beat humor.

Sergeant Doubleday—known affectionately as Dodo—has risen through the ranks faster than any recruit could imagine, thanks to an astonishing photographic memory that lets him recite every regulation and weapon manual verbatim. Though his encyclopedic knowledge makes him a popular lecturer on ballistics and firearms disassembly, he remains painfully gun‑shy, his shooting skills lagging far behind his theoretical expertise. Opposite him stand Sergeant Ames and Sergeant Cobb, battle‑hardened veterans whose confidence in the rifle range is as solid as their rivalry with one another, and with Dodo.

Seeing an opportunity to settle bragging rights, the colonel, buoyed by a mix of curiosity and optimism, wagers a month’s pay on Dodo’s ability to outshoot his two best marksmen. The challenge, framed as good‑natured competition, quickly becomes a focal point for the camp’s underlying tensions, especially when Betty Barkley—the colonel’s daughter—gets drawn into the mix, further blurring the lines between camaraderie and contest.
